钟二网络头像

钟二网络

探索SQL查询技巧、Linux系统运维以及Web开发前沿技术,提供一站式的学习体验

  • 文章92531
  • 阅读817488
首页 SQL 正文内容

用连接池写sql增加语句

钟逸 SQL 2024-05-12 20:40:26 33

随着Web应用的不断发展,数据库操作的性能也变得越来越重要。使用连接池可以有效提升数据库操作的性能,减少系统资源消耗,提高响应速度。

什么是连接池?

连接池是一种预先创建好的一组数据库连接,应用程序可以通过连接池来获取和释放数据库连接。当应用程序需要访问数据库时,它可以从连接池中获取一个可用连接,而不用每次都重新创建连接。当应用程序完成对数据库的操作后,它可以将连接释放回连接池,供其他应用程序使用。

使用连接池的好处

使用连接池可以带来以下好处:

* 减少系统资源消耗:连接池可以减少频繁创建和销毁数据库连接的系统开销。

* 提高响应速度:应用程序可以从连接池中快速获取可用连接,从而减少等待时间,提高响应速度。

* 提高稳定性:连接池可以避免数据库连接池耗尽导致的应用程序崩溃。

用连接池写sql增加语句

在应用程序中使用连接池写sql增加语句,可以遵循以下步骤:

1. **获取数据库连接:**从连接池中获取一个可用连接。

2. **创建sql语句:**准备要执行的sql增加语句。

3. **执行sql语句:**使用连接执行sql增加语句。

4. **释放数据库连接:**将连接释放回连接池。

案例演示

以下是一个使用连接池写sql增加语句的示例代码:

java

// 获取数据库连接

Connection connection = connectionPool.getConnection();

// 创建sql语句

String sql = "INSERT INTO users (username, password) VALUES (?, ?)";

// 准备sql语句

PreparedStatement statement = connection.prepareStatement(sql);

// 设置sql语句参数

statement.setString(1, "小红书");

statement.setString(2, "123456");

// 执行sql语句

int rowCount = statement.executeUpdate();

// 释放数据库连接

connectionPool.releaseConnection(connection);

结语

使用连接池可以有效提升数据库操作的性能,在实际的Web应用开发中,结合业务需求和系统架构,合理使用连接池,可以显著提高应用程序的效率和稳定性。

文章目录
    搜索